Output 24ae54238873fc3ea6e30262c81c42185d64c61ea24f50c4812223df3fb33a7a:0

value
88377880
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 890c365875c8048e0b3734efb420970985638585799953211e5a5722ad7537b8
address
tb1p3yxrvkr4eqzguzehxnhmggyhpxzk8pv90xv4xgg7tftj9tt4x7uqmfee4x
transaction
24ae54238873fc3ea6e30262c81c42185d64c61ea24f50c4812223df3fb33a7a
confirmations
19072
spent
true